About Hinkley Point C
HPC is one of four EPR Technology Power Stations and forms part of EDF's vision for a sustainable, low-carbon future. The CommOps team ensures that all people, systems and facilities are ready for the safe and efficient operation of the power station when it begins generating electricity.
